Cardinals fly past Muskies

The Muskingum men's basketball team fell at home against Otterbein on Saturday afternoon, 75-64.

Junior Logan Kimble led the Muskies with 16 points. He also added five rebounds, three steals and two assists.

Sophomore Christian Keller had 15 points and six rebounds, while sophomore Cody Seiler narrowly missed a double-double with 14 points and nine boards.

Senior Dave Brown entered the game just three free throws shy of the Muskingum consecutive free throw record of 38 set by Zach Ross during the 2003-04 campaign. Brown made his first two free throws in the opening half, but missed his third attempt in the second half.

Muskingum connected on 19-of-54 (.352) from the field and was haunted by a 1-of-14 performance from behind the arc and 14 turnovers.

Jake Bischoff led a quad of Cardinals in double digits with 20 points. Grant Fenner logged a double-double with 15 points and 10 boards.

Otterbein (2-5, 1-1) ended the outing shooting .375 (21-of-56) from the floor.

An evenly played first half saw Otterbein take a 26-25 lead into the break.

In the second half, the Muskies led 51-46 at the 10-minute mark after an alley-oop dunk by Kimble sent the Recreation Center into a screaming frenzy. Otterbein quickly answered with back-to-back three-point shots to take a 52-51 lead. The game remained a one possession contest until Otterbein took a 65-60 edge on a basket with 2:28 to play. The Cardinals made eight straight free throws in the final two minutes to break open the tight contest.

Muskingum (3-2, 0-2) next travels to Ohio Northern on Saturday, December 14. Game time is scheduled for 4:00 p.m.
